    The Euan MacDonald Centre for Motor Neurone Disease Research is an academic and UK National Health Service collaboration that unites over 200 scientists, doctors and specialist nurses across Scotland. By working together to better understand the causes, biological processes and impact of MND, we aim to improve the lives of people living with MND today, and to work towards treatments for tomorrow.
